Amenities

The Queen's Head Hotel in Berwick Upon Tweed offers six thoughtfully designed bedrooms, each featuring ensuite bathrooms. Guests can take advantage of the secure outdoor bike storage area, catering to those who travel on two wheels. The bar area provides a space for relaxation, serving a selection of premium beverages.

Rooms

The hotel comprises three twin rooms, two double rooms, and a spacious family room, accommodating various group sizes. Each room comes with pocket-sprung mattresses and hypo-allergenic pillows, promoting a restful sleep. Recent refurbishments have respected the hotel's Grade II listed status while offering contemporary comfort.

Location

Located on Sandgate, the hotel is within walking distance of the historical walls and quayside of Berwick Upon Tweed. This locale provides guests with easy access to the charming streets and local attractions. The surrounding area enriches the experience, showcasing the beauty of Berwick's architecture.

Dining

The hotel's bistro serves breakfast, brunch, and traditional pub food, with an emphasis on local products. Guests are reminded to reserve a table for lunch or dinner to enjoy freshly sourced seafood and locally raised beef. The commitment to sourcing within a 15-mile radius offers diners traceability and authenticity in their meals.

Family-Friendly Accommodations

The family room at Queen's Head accommodates a double bed and a single bed, providing ample space for families. Additional options for cots or extra beds add to its convenience. The welcoming atmosphere ensures families feel at home during their stay.
